| traumatic cataract | A cataract caused by contusion, rupture, or a foreign body. (05 Mar 2000) |
|---|---|
| juvenile cataract | A soft cataract occurring in a child or young adult. (05 Mar 2000) |
| umbilicated cataract | Congenital cataract in which a central white membrane replaces the nucleus. Synonym: disk-shaped cataract, life-belt cataract, umbilicated c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
| zonular cataract | A cataract in which the opacity is limited to the cortex. Synonym: zonular c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
| fibroid cataract | A sclerotic hardening of the capsule of the lens, following exudative iridocyclitis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| floriform cataract | A congenital cataract with opacities arranged like the petals of a flower. (05 Mar 2000) |
| lamellar cataract | A cataract in which the opacity is limited to the cortex. Synonym: zonular c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
| furnacemen's cataract | A cataract secondary to absorption of heat by the lens, or by transmission from the adjacent iris. Synonym: furnacemen's cataract, glassworker's c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
| fusiform cataract | A cataract in which the opacity is fusiform, extending from one pole to the other. Synonym: fusiform c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
| life-belt cataract | Congenital cataract in which a central white membrane replaces the nucleus. Synonym: disk-shaped cataract, life-belt cataract, umbilicated cataract. (05 Mar 2000) |
